500 Hryvnias Note.

Denomination: 500 Hryvnias
Year: 2006
Description: Face side: The portrait of Hryhoriy Skovoroda (1722 – 1794), a great Ukrainian philosopher and scientist of the 18th century. The part of a see-through element – digital label of nominal value '500' is located in 'window', not occupied in printing, shaped as parallelogram. The background of a central part of the note creates an image of a fountain with an inscription 'Unequal by all equality' – author's picture of H. Skovoroda’s novel.
Back side: Image of a Kyiv-Mogilyansk Academy’s building. Above it there is a decorative element as the stamp of Kyiv-Mogilyansk Academy used in ХVІІІ century. At the left there is a graphics image of author's picture H. Skovoroda to his novel ('Pythagorean Triangle').
Dimensions: 75 х 154 mm. The predominant color is bright yellow. Serial No БК 7248901.
The banknote was printed on special beige paper with its main color corresponding to the predominant color of the banknote. It is non-fluorescent paper with a multi-tone local watermark, light watermark element, double-tone watermark (bar-code), security thread and security fibers. The note also has light watermark element; optically variable ink; rainbow printing; antiscanning grid; microtext; latent image; see-through element; invisible security fibers; fluorescent number; relief printing; security thread; magnetic number; symbol for the partially sighted; orloff ptinting.
September 15, 2006. Printed at the Banknote Printing and Minting Works of the National Bank of Ukraine.
Country or town: Ukraine
